How do I become a copy editor?
Copy editors typically earn at least a bachelor's degree in journalism, English or related fields. Journalism programs offer coursework relevant to the profession that allows the student to develop editing, writing, fact checking, page layout, Web design and proofreading skills.
How do you become a certified proofreader?
You do not have to be certified to work as a proofreader. Gain experience in writing and grammar. You can complete a degree with a major in English or take technical writing courses. Take journalism courses, including copy editing and online editing.

What does copy editing mean?
Copy editing (also copy editing, sometimes abbreviated CE) is the process of reviewing and correcting written material to improve accuracy, readability, and fitness for its purpose, and to ensure that it is free of error, omission, inconsistency, and repetition. Copy editing has three levels: light, medium, and heavy.
What is the difference between copy editing and editing?
Difference between Editing and Copy editing. It can be difficult to decide whether you should use editing or copy editing services to polish your manuscript. Editing focuses on the meaning of your content, while copy editing focuses on its technical quality.
How do you do copy editing?
Clarify your role. First, determine what level of copy editing you're providing.
Give the text an initial read-through.
Read it again and make a plan.
Go line-by-line.
Format the text.
Do a final read.
